    I'm not a huge fan of fake unless you buy the really high end ones. The greenery usually fall really short of something that looks authentic. Fake does let you diy your flowers weeks in advance though.

    I’m doing fake silk flowers because 1. I want to keep them forever and 2. I want a lot of tropical and unusual flowers that simply aren’t available in this part of the country and the time frame for shipping would make them too expensive and they wouldn’t be as fresh-looking as the silk alternatives.

    Keep in mind if you are doing diy if you use Real you will be putting them together the day before or morning of the wedding. With silk you can do it ahead of time.
